What Is Child Support Law?
Child support law governs the financial responsibilities of parents to support their children after separation or divorce. Its goal is to ensure a child’s basic needs — housing, food, clothing, education, and medical care — are met. While laws vary by state, child support is typically paid by the non-custodial parent to the custodial parent. The amount is determined based on factors like each parent’s income, the needs of the child, and state guidelines. These laws aim to provide a fair distribution of financial support, ensuring a child maintains a similar standard of living as they would have if their parents were together.
What Does Child Support Cover?
A judge will order child support payments to make sure all of your child’s needs are met when you and your ex are no longer together and spending money. These payments can help cover expenses for your child like school, health care, food, clothing, housing, and more.
How Much Is Child Support?
Each state, including Arizona calculates child support according to its formula. This formula will take into account your earnings, your ex’s earnings, and your child’s financial needs for things like school, health care, food, and other necessities. A child support lawyer will be able to better help you anticipate what you expect to either owe or receive in child support payments.
How Can I Change My Child Support Payments?
If you feel you pay too much child support or receive too little, you must prove a “substantial” change in circumstances to change your child support obligations. This means major changes will need to happen to either your or your ex’s income or your child’s financial needs. Some changes that can bring about a modification of support could include a raise, losing a job, or a serious illness.
How Does Child Support Affect My Taxes?
Because child support payments are solely for the child’s benefit, they do not affect tax filings. If you pay child support, you cannot deduct those payments from your income, and if you receive child support, those payments will not count toward your taxable income. If you are late on child support payments, your state may intercept your tax refund to help pay off those debts.
What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Child Support Lawyer?
You might need a child support lawyer if you:
- Are going through a divorce or separation and need to establish child support
- Need to modify an existing child support order due to changes in income or living arrangements
- Need to enforce a support order when payments are not being made
- Need to address disputes over the amount of support
- Suspect the other parent is hiding assets that will affect the amount of support
All of this is especially true if you cannot get along with your ex.
